0

有什么理由为什么这段代码不能在本地运行的 JS 3.1.0 上运行(从http://jquery.com/download/下载)但是当我从http://ajax.googleapis.com/ajax/加载它时运行良好libs/jquery/1.6.1/jquery.min.js

<script>
$(window).load(function() {
$(".se-pre-con").fadeOut("slow");;
});
</script>

我很困惑...请帮助...

4

2 回答 2

1

在 Jquery 3.0 版中删除了 load() 方法。

检查此链接以了解有关 Jquery 3.0 版的更多更改 https://jquery.com/upgrade-guide/3.0/#break-change-load-unload-and-error-removed

于 2017-02-15T05:29:24.730 回答
1

您在此处使用的 jQuery http://ajax.googleapis.com/ajax/libs/jquery/1.6.1/jquery.min.js使用 jQuery 1.6.1,而您从https 下载的 jQuery: //jquery.com/download/使用 jQuery 3

在此处的 jQuery 3 文档中,它说:

重大更改:删除了 .load()、.unload() 和 .error()

因此,.load()您可以$(function() {});像这样使用,而不是使用:

$(function() {
  // insert code here...
});
于 2017-02-15T05:20:37.553 回答